Web27 de mar. de 2024 · Maryland early voting dates. Early voting starts: 12 days before Election Day; Early voting ends: 5 days before Election Day; What to bring. Only first-time voters need to show ID. You can show a driver's license from any state, a US passport or passport card, a tribal ID, a military ID, or any other government-issued photo ID. Web27 de oct. de 2016 · Early voting starts on Thursday, October 27, 2024, and goes through Thursday, November 3, 2024. Each early voting center will be open continuously from 7: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m. each day. Anyone in line at 8:00 p.m. will be allowed to vote.
